What is the " Make the Earth Your Own " program?

Program Goals
Gain a global sustainability perspective and change mindset

The program aims to create a sustainable world where not only people but also animals, nature, and all other life forms can choose to live in a more abundant way,
This is a human resource development program for the next generation of leaders who will contribute to global social issues, aiming for a sustainable world in which everyone shines.

In the nature-rich field of Adventure World, about 1,600 animals of about 120 species are our partners, Through the acquisition of a sustainability perspective through a cross-boundary experience that fully utilizes the five senses and artistic thinking, The goal of the program is to develop human resources who can think from a broader perspective and run on their own through the verbalization of their "origin (≒purpose)".

Feature 2

Origin exploration through art thinking (≒setting personal paths)

Art thinking is the systematization of an artist's thought process.
Through thought experiments that make full use of the five senses and a broad view of time and space, the "origins" that form individual values and philosophies are verbalized and expressed.
Based on intrinsic motivation, we aim to develop paradigm-shifting human resources capable of envisioning a sustainable society and business in a big way.
